Academic Year: 2022-2023 Class: Programmazione Calcolatori (Class) Created: April 5, 2023 Tag: C MOC Type:Lecture
- Correzione esercizio per casa: costruire funzione che trova la posizione degli spazzi vuoti di una stringa.
- funzione C realloc Function
- implementazione funzione pop (usando realloc)
- implementazione di una lista stile python
implementazione lista in c stile python
- array non conterrà più gli elementi ma sarà composto da puntatori che puntano agli elementi
- utilizziamo *void come puntatore in modo da poter puntare a dati di tipo diverso (e utilizzare Casting per accedere ai giusto tipo di puntatore)
Struttura:
- Utilizziamo una normale lista i cui elementi puntano a delle strutture (objects) che contengono 2 informazioni:
-
- Il tipo di elemento (type) es: type = ‘i’ (intero)
-
- L’ elemento vero e proprio sotto dorma di puntatore
-